The agreement in 1944 recognized central financial management rules between Australia, Japan, the United States, Canada, and a number of Western European countries. Generally, the world's economy was in shambles after World War II, so 730 delegates from 44 Allied nations gathered in New Hampshire in a hotel called Bretton Woods. Exchange Rates.

Treasury department official Harry Dexter White. Many historians believe the closed-door Bretton Woods conference centralized the entire world's monetary system (Global Financial System). On the meeting's last day, Bretton Woods delegates codified a code of rules for the world's financial system and invoked the World Bank Group and the IMF. Basically, because the U.S. managed more than two-thirds of the world's gold, the system would count on gold and the U.S. dollar. However, Richard Nixon shocked the world when he eliminated the gold part out of the Bretton Woods pact in August 1971. As soon as the Bretton Woods system was up and running, a variety of individuals criticized the strategy and said the Bretton Woods conference and subsequent creations strengthened world inflation.

The editorialist was Henry Hazlitt and his posts like "End the IMF" were extremely questionable to the status quo. In the editorial, Hazlitt said that he composed extensively about how the introduction of the IMF had actually triggered huge nationwide currency devaluations. Hazlitt discussed the British pound lost a third of its worth over night in 1949. "In the years from completion of 1952 to the end of 1962, 43 leading currencies diminished," the financial expert detailed back in 1963. "The U.S. dollar revealed a loss in internal purchasing power of 12 percent, the British pound of 25 percent, the French franc of 30 percent.
